Default Re: ACF50 application

1" paint brush with long bristles. I got the bottle (950ml?) with pump spray bottle from Wemoto, cheapest I could find at the time. It goes a long way, only needs to be used sparingly. Keep a rag for wiping down in a tin or jar, often don't need to apply any more, just wipe over with the "loaded" rag. It really does creep and spread into all the nooks and crannies.

It is very good stuff. I was recently given a load of tools, milling cutters/drill bits etc which had a few patches of rust from years of storage. Soaked everything for a week or so, nearly all the crud has cleaned off with only the deeper pits still showing. Excellent.

Default Re: ACF50 application

I do mine twice a year, if you wash the bike with cold water just to get the suface carp off you won't wash away the ACF50, then when you want to reapply it do a hot soapy wash and it comes right off, simple.
